As prospective students explore their options, it is essential to note the admission requirements for the Master of Science in Physics. Applicants are generally expected to hold a bachelor’s degree in physics or a closely related field. A solid foundation in mathematics and science is crucial, as coursework will demand strong analytical skills. While standardized test scores such as GRE may not be required, applicants must demonstrate proficiency in English through tests like TOEFL, with a minimum score of 85 out of 120.
The application process entails a fee of $75, along with submission of academic transcripts, letters of recommendation, and a statement of purpose.
